diff options
author | tuexen <tuexen@FreeBSD.org> | 2016-01-16 18:08:05 +0000 |
---|---|---|
committer | tuexen <tuexen@FreeBSD.org> | 2016-01-16 18:08:05 +0000 |
commit | 3f469327b2218f53eb6581518744d44c40aeb535 (patch) | |
tree | 54f6de74db08a6c4ed939aa45950dd00efc6e4ce /sys/netinet | |
parent | 77521945a3e5ddb68cda72bb9e983d629929de5f (diff) | |
download | FreeBSD-src-3f469327b2218f53eb6581518744d44c40aeb535.zip FreeBSD-src-3f469327b2218f53eb6581518744d44c40aeb535.tar.gz |
MFC r290468:
Use the correct length. The wrong one was too large.
Diffstat (limited to 'sys/netinet')
-rw-r--r-- | sys/netinet/sctp_indata.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/sys/netinet/sctp_indata.c b/sys/netinet/sctp_indata.c index 3f00c24..9c72d8b 100644 --- a/sys/netinet/sctp_indata.c +++ b/sys/netinet/sctp_indata.c @@ -225,7 +225,7 @@ sctp_build_ctl_nchunk(struct sctp_inpcb *inp, struct sctp_sndrcvinfo *sinfo) if (sctp_is_feature_on(inp, SCTP_PCB_FLAGS_RECVNXTINFO) && (seinfo->serinfo_next_flags & SCTP_NEXT_MSG_AVAIL)) { provide_nxt = 1; - len += CMSG_SPACE(sizeof(struct sctp_rcvinfo)); + len += CMSG_SPACE(sizeof(struct sctp_nxtinfo)); } else { provide_nxt = 0; } |